Understanding the RLE Treatment
Refractive lens exchange (RLE) includes a collection of precise steps made to improve your vision.
Initially, your optometrist will certainly perform an extensive evaluation to assess your eye health and wellness and establish if you're a suitable candidate.
Once authorized, you'll obtain a local anesthetic to ensure comfort throughout the treatment.
Your surgeon will make a tiny incision in your cornea, permitting access to the gloomy lens. They'll meticulously remove it and change it with a tailored synthetic lens customized to your specific vision requirements.
The procedure generally takes concerning 15-30 mins, and you'll be awake throughout.
Afterward, you'll receive post-operative instructions to help make certain a smooth recuperation, permitting you to enjoy your enhanced vision in a snap.
Advantages and Dangers of RLE
After understanding the RLE treatment, it is necessary to evaluate the benefits and threats associated with it.
One major advantage is the potential for improved vision, allowing you to lower or remove the demand for glasses or contact lenses. Lots of patients experience enhanced quality of life and greater liberty in daily activities.
Nonetheless, like any kind of surgical treatment, RLE brings risks. Complications can consist of infection, retinal detachment, or vision changes that may not be correctable. There's likewise the opportunity of needing added treatments.
It's necessary to have an extensive discussion with your eye care professional concerning your certain situation. By considering these variables meticulously, you can make an enlightened choice concerning whether RLE is the right choice for you.
